Zomato
FoodinYVR
+4.5
Madness Wednesday $35. Spaghetti alla Puttanesca (spaghetti with DOP tomato sauce, garlic, anchovies, black olives, capers, and parsley) $18 4/5 - Al dente! A little on the salty side. Garlic was not too strong.
Spaghetti alla Carbonara (typical recipe from Lazio made with free range eggs, guanciale and Pecorino) $18 1/5 - It was undercooked! The middle was still hard. We had to send it back to the kitchen. On the second attempt, it was still undercooked. Not as bad as the last time. I just had a bite of it. The second attempt was saltier than the first one for some reason. We would expect that's the way they serve if we didn't had the Puttanesca.
Ravioli alla Piemontese (handmade ravioli stuffed with beef served with Piedmontese sauce) $22 3.5/5 - I had high expectations for this because it was handmade. I could barely taste the beef. There were about 20 pieces pieces of raviolis.
Quattro Stagioni (tomato, mozzarella, cooked ham, mushrooms, black olives with pits, artichokes, anchovies) $20 3.5/5- very similar to the Prosciutto e Funghi. The artichokes were a little too salty. I don't remember having any anchovies. It was thicker than the Prosciutto e Funghi.
Prosciutto e Funghi (tomato, mozzarella, cooked ham, mushrooms) $17 4/5- my favourite of the 3 pizza. It was plan and simple. Very thin crust.
Pancetta & Gorgonzola (tomato, mozzarella, pancetta, gorgonzola) $17 3.5/5 - simple but the pancetta was salty.
Panna Cotta (an Italian classic dessert made with real vanilla beans. Served as a chilled disk with strawberry sauce and chocolate sauce) $8 4.5/5 - Nothing much can go wrong with a panna cotta. The bottom of the panna cotta (or the top since it was upside down) was harder than the top. I have no idea how this could happen. Both the strawberry sauce and the chocolate sauce was a little too much for me. I would prefer to pick one.
Tiramisu (made with Italian savoiardi lady biscuits dipped in espresso, Italian Mascarpone and flavoured with cocoa) $9 4/5 - not too sweet. I wish the mascarpone cheese was thicker.
Chocolate Brick (a typical Italian dessert prepared with biscuits and cocoa, crunchy and tasty) $7 3/5 - reminded us of Oreo. It was more on the hard side than crunchy.

The portions are on the smaller size even though our server claimed they were 12" pizzas. The toppings were not spreadout evenly on the top. Some of us liked it that way and said she could pick and choose the toppings she wanted. The 5 of us shared 3 Madness Wednesday special (pizza+pasta+dessert for $35). We were told that the special is enough for 2. Service was a little slow. We waited 40min for our pizza after having the pasta. Our server Matteo was super nice and funny. We had a girls' talk and at the end Matteo told us that women in Vancouver are not happy. He suggested we should go to Italy to look for our husbands! He also didn't charge us our undercooked carbonara.
